Friendship Cities

Kobe (神戶), Japan – since July 23, 2010

Since the opening of the Port of Kobe in 1868, the food industry, including western-style confections, Kobe beef, and liquor, as well as fashion and tourism industries have become well developed in the city. In an attempt to restore the urban infrastructure that was destroyed during the 1995 Great Hanshin earthquake, the city built a biomedical innovation cluster on an artificial island called Port Island, which is the largest advanced medical cluster in Japan. Kobe was appointed to the UNESCO Creative Cities Network as a City of Design, and currently it is dedicated to creating a city of design through its residents’ participation

  • Location : southern Hyogo Prefecture, Japan
  • Population : 1.52 million
  • Area : 557 km2
